Optimization of Cutting Parameters in High Speed Milling of Thin-Walled Structure Components

摘要

In this paper, the existent studies on machining errors of the thin-walled structure components are reviewed firstly, then the cutting forces and the machining errors caused by them in high speed milling are analyzed theoretically and experimentally under different cutting parameters. Based on these studies, the principle of selecting optimal cutting parameters in high speed milling of thin-walled structure components are presented. It is shown that under the precondition of ensuring machining precision of the thin-walled structure components, the machining efficiency has been improved greatly using the cutting parameters determined by the principle compared with using the conventional ones.
